Christians are to submit to all types of government 7
Series Jesus' Response to Government
Three general principles:
#1: Every Christian must submit to everything the government requires of him or her, even if it is oppressive, unjust, or against one’s own personal standards and beliefs, as long as what the government requires is not contrary to what God requires in His word
#2: It is much more pleasing to God that we as God’s people maintain His ordained authority structure by submitting to government, no matter how flawed it is, than to rebel against that structure even if it violates His moral standards
#3: From God’s standpoint, regardless of how bad any government is, any government is better than no government at all
Four principles related to civil disobedience:
Principle #1: When God’s people are called by government to unjustly take a human life, they are to disobey that command
Principle #2: When God’s people are called by government to worship another god, they are to disobey that command
Principle #3: When God’s people are called by government to forsake their devotion to God, they are to disobey that command
Principle #4: When God’s people are called by government to silence the gospel, they are to disobey that command
Summary principle: When government tells us to do something God calls us not to do, or tells us not to do something God tells us to do, we have to disobey government
